Galway, a city of arts and sensational pubs
Galway might be one of the biggest cities in the ever cheerful Ireland, but when compared to other European cities, which are 10 times bigger Galway seems to be a touristic El Dorado. Galway doesn’t lack the history, not the landscape, nor the thrill, which is why the city receives no less than 2 million visits each year.. Although the population of Galway can be rounded up to a mere 75 k, this picturesque city bu the sea is growing at a very fast rate. Galway is one of the oldest Irish ports, but its economical importance looses its meaning when compared to the city’s artistic and cultural life. A city with less than 100 000 inhabitants and so many theaters, galleries, ballet companies and events is not a common sight, no matter what country we speak of. Even the pubs serve as cultural institutions in Galway, as many tourists praise the lively atmosphere and first quality live music the had the chance to encounter in Galway’s numerous bars and pubs. And you can always count on Galway to surprise you with some dance festival or local fair, no matter what time of the year you happed to be there.
